LNMPは、Linuxオペレーティングシステムの下でNginx、MySQL、およびPHP環境構成であり、PHPアプレットの背景を構築および実行するためによく使用されます。 Windowsシステムの場合、WNMP構成、つまり、Windowsオペレーティングシステムの下でNginx、MySQL、およびPHP環境を使用します。これは、PHPアプレットの開発と展開にも適しています。
まず、Linuxオペレーティングシステムがサーバーにインストールされていることを確認し、一般的なシステムがUbuntuとCentosであることを確認してください。インストール後、システムの更新を実行し、基本的な構成を実行します。
端末にnginxをインストールします。
sudo apt-get update
sudo apt-get install nginx
インストールが完了したら、nginxのブーツを有効にし、Nginxサービスを開始します。
sudo systemctl enable nginx
sudo systemctl start nginx
次のコマンドを実行してMySQLをインストールします。
sudo apt-get install mysql-server
sudo mysql_secure_installation
インストールプロセス中に、ルートパスワードを設定し、セキュリティ構成を作成するように求められます。
PHPとその関連モジュールをインストールします。
sudo apt-get install php-fpm php-mysql
次に、PHP構成ファイルPHP.iniを編集し、いくつかの一般的な構成項目を設定します。
cgi.fix_pathinfo=0
upload_max_filesize=32M
post_max_size=32M
date.timezone=Asia/Shanghai
完了後、エディターを保存して終了し、PHP-FPMサービスを再起動して構成を適用します。
sudo systemctl restart php7.4-fpm
Nginxの公式Webサイトにアクセスし、Windows用のインストールパッケージをダウンロードして、指定されたディレクトリに抽出します。
MySQL公式Webサイトからインストールパッケージをダウンロードし、インストールウィザードに従ってインストールを完了します。
Windows用のPHPインストールパッケージをダウンロードし、指定されたディレクトリに解凍し、PHP.iniファイルを構成します。
LNMPとWNMPは、PHPアプレットの背景を展開するための一般的な環境構成です。 LinuxシステムであろうとWindowsシステムであろうと、NGINX、MYSQL、PHPをインストールおよび構成した後、安定した高速開発環境を構築できます。これにより、背景の安定した動作を確保するために、PHP Miniプログラム開発の効率的なサーバーサポートが提供されます。